While a small breed, Yorkshire Terriers are full of energy and are a wonderful companion for families or individuals. They are very adaptable and can adjust well to various lifestyles, including living in apartments. However, they need regular grooming to keep their long, luxurious coats in great condition.

Yorkies are more susceptible to health problems than larger breeds due to their smaller size. Eye issues, patellar deflation hypoglycaemia and tracheal collapse are all common issues. They could also develop bladder stones or difficulties dealing with dental procedures. In addition, due to their energy levels, Yorkies need plenty of physical and mental stimulation to avoid the destructive and boredom. They thrive in dog parks and in yards that are fenced.

Yorkshire Terrier Information

The Yorkie is a tiny breed that makes for a wonderful companion. They are intelligent dogs that have a strong bond with their owners and are very sensitive to the moods of the people around them. Yorkies are playful but they also like to relax and unwind with their family members.

Due to their small size, Yorkies make great pets for people who live in apartments and smaller homes. They can be taken along on trains or planes. They require regular grooming, including regular baths with a shampoo that keeps hairs healthy and moisturized, trimming of the nails every six weeks, and brushing the coat between 2 and every 4 days (depending on length).

They are simple to train, provided consistent training methods are used. They are cautious of strangers, and they are not the best watchdogs. However, they are loyal to family members. Yorkshire Terrier Health

If you are looking for a small dog that has low demands on exercise, the Yorkshire Terrier may be the best breed for you. Be prepared to spend many hours cleaning them. They have a long, smooth coat that needs to be brushed regularly using a steel-bristled brush in order to avoid knotting and matting. You should also dampen the coat with water and a light conditioner to keep it shining.

These little dogs can also be susceptible to tracheal collapsing an illness in which the supporting structures that surround the windpipe weaken over time, reducing the airway and making breathing difficult.
